Francis Dunnery, co-founder of It Bites, has had a fascinating career, collaborating with legends like Robert Plant and Santana. In a recent interview, he shared insights about his life, career, and the music industry.

Dunnery reminisced about his time with Plant, describing it as ‘the biggest guitar job in the world.’ He emphasized the importance of embracing opportunities as they come and letting go when they leave. His unpredictable career has seen him navigate the highs and lows of the music scene, from the success of It Bites to his solo ventures.

Reflecting on the evolution of progressive rock, Dunnery noted that while much of it has become a caricature, it still holds a special place for fans. He believes in the power of music as escapism, even if it may seem pointless at times.

As he continues to perform with It Bites FD and explore new projects, Dunnery remains committed to his artistic vision, proving that the journey of a musician is as important as the destination.
